Calling all ECT Early Careers Teachers across Leicester and Leicestershire now and for academic year 2025-26.

Are you an ECT looking for a school to start your ECT year come September 2025? Are you an ECT on final placement and don't want to wait until September 2025 to start working and wanting to start work from June 2025?

Monarch Education is working in partnership with Primary Schools & Academies across the Leicester / Leicestershire area. We also work collaboratively with local Universities and PGCE Course Leaders who refer Monarch to ECTs seeking work in schools this academic year.

We are recruiting candidates who are seeking full-time positions in order to support their ECT year in EYFS, KS1, and KS2 in various schools across the Leicester / Leicestershire area. You will be placed in a supportive school environment where you will be given the guidance, help, and knowledge you need to assist with your development, ensuring that you achieve.
